Harnessing AI for Dynamic Email Personalization

The rise of artificial intelligence is revolutionizing how businesses approach email marketing. Recent advancements are enabling marketers to deliver hyper-personalized content, transforming standard newsletters into tailored communications that resonate with individual recipients.

AI-driven platforms are streamlining data analysis, allowing marketers to better understand consumer behaviors and preferences. For instance, tools like Mailchimp and ActiveCampaign are incorporating predictive analytics to anticipate the most effective timing and content for each email. This kind of automation saves time while enhancing engagement rates, a key metric in today’s competitive landscape.

Current Trends in Email Personalization

Several trends illustrate how AI is shaping personalized email marketing:

  • Predictive Content: AI algorithms analyze user data to predict the topics and products that a recipient is likely to engage with.
  • Behavioral Targeting: Businesses are now leveraging behavioral data, indicating user interactions across platforms, to craft emails that reflect past behaviors.
  • Real-Time Adjustments: With AI, it’s possible to adjust email content in real-time based on how users interact with previous campaigns.

Actionable Steps for Businesses

  1. Invest in AI Tools: Choose email marketing platforms that offer advanced AI functionalities. Evaluate features like predictive analytics, segmentation capabilities, and automation of personalized journeys.
  2. Analyze User Data: It’s essential to gather and analyze customer data comprehensively. Look at past purchases, browsing history, and engagement metrics to inform your email strategies.
  3. A/B Test Personalization: Experiment with different personalization approaches. Test subject lines, email designs, and content variations to uncover what resonates best with your audience.
